Supercharge Your Innovation With Domain-Expert AI Agents!

High-concurrency terminal firmware updating method and updating system

A firmware update and firmware technology, applied in the field of drones, can solve the problems of easy loss of firmware data, slow update process, and low concurrency.

Pending Publication Date: 2020-09-25
深圳大漠大智控技术有限公司
View PDF6 Cites 0 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0004] 1. One update can only target one terminal, and the number of concurrency is small;
[0005] 2. The firmware data is not encrypted during the transmission process, resulting in easy loss of firmware data;
[0006] 3. Firmware flashing is carried out while the firmware data is being transmitted, resulting in a slow update process

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• High-concurrency terminal firmware updating method and updating system
  • High-concurrency terminal firmware updating method and updating system

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0043] The following will clearly and completely describe the technical solutions in the embodiments of the present invention with reference to the accompanying drawings in the embodiments of the present invention. Obviously, the described embodiments are some of the embodiments of the present invention, but not all of them. Based on the embodiments of the present invention, all other embodiments obtained by persons of ordinary skill in the art without making creative efforts belong to the protection scope of the present invention.

[0044] It should be understood that when used in this specification and the appended claims, the terms "comprising" and "comprises" indicate the presence of described features, integers, steps, operations, elements and / or components, but do not exclude one or Presence or addition of multiple other features, integers, steps, operations, elements, components and / or collections thereof.

[0045] It should also be understood that the terminology used ...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ention discloses a high-concurrency terminal firmware updating method and updating system. The updating method comprises the steps that a ground station synchronously sends to-be-updated firmware and an updating starting command to airborne computers of multiple unmanned aerial vehicles in the same batch; each airborne computer receives the firmware to be updated and the update starting command, and forwards the update starting command to the corresponding flight control system; the flight control system automatically restarts after receiving the update starting command; the airborne computer automatically restarts and sends firmware flashing data to the flight control system; the flight control system performs flashing operation according to the received flashing data of the firmware; and the ground station continuously and synchronously sends the firmware to be updated and the updating starting command to the plurality of airborne computers in the next batch after finishing sending the firmware to be updated and the updating starting command to the plurality of airborne computers in the batch. According to the invention, the concurrent quantity and updating speed of terminal firmware updating can be effectively improved.

Description

technical field [0001] The invention relates to the technical field of unmanned aerial vehicles, in particular to a method and system for updating firmware of high-concurrency terminals. Background technique [0002] Unmanned aerial vehicle, full name unmanned aircraft, abbreviated as "UAV", is an unmanned aircraft controlled by radio remote control equipment and self-contained program control device, or completely or intermittently operated autonomously by on-board computer. In terms of military use, UAVs are divided into reconnaissance aircraft and target aircraft. In terms of civilian use, drones + industry applications are the real rigid needs of drones; currently, they are used in aerial photography, agriculture, plant protection, micro selfies, express delivery, disaster relief, wildlife observation, infectious disease monitoring, surveying and mapping, news reports, power patrols, etc. Inspection, disaster relief, film and television shooting, romantic manufacturing ...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): G06F8/65
CPCG06F8/65
Inventor 邓江华刘汉斌
Owner 深圳大漠大智控技术有限公司
Features
  • R&D
  • Intellectual Property
  • Life Sciences
  • Materials
  • Tech Scout
Why Patsnap Eureka
  • Unparalleled Data Quality
  • Higher Quality Content
  • 60% Fewer Hallucinations
Social media
Patsnap Eureka Blog
Learn More